Rhino-Rack Roof Mounted Steel Cargo Basket - 47" Long x 35" Wide - 165 lbs
the good: strong. lots of anchor points. secure once assembled. gaps between bars are small, stuff doesn't slip through and hit my roof. reasonably priced. mounts securely. on and off relatively easily. holds a good amount of cargo. weight limit is more than my roof can handle anyway. the bad: assembly is a pain and didn't fit exactly. small rust spots developing. heavy. plastic wind deflector cracked from a rock. lots of wind noise driving at high speeds. overall. i recommend this basket. had some assembly issues because the two pieces didn't fit into each other easily, one side is slightly off-center. wish the plastic wind deflector was metal instead. i've used it several times and have no real issues with it.

Curt Roof Mounted Cargo Basket - 64-1/2" Long x 37" Wide x 4" Tall - 150 lbs
Put this on an 2023 Rav 4 Hybrid- Easy to put together. You might need two people to get it up on top. Strong. Will create some wind noise after install. Solid build and construction.
I only use the roof rack for vacations because they make cars so small on the interior now a days. It handles quite a bit of luggage. Including two big size luggage and two small is how I travel. Make sure to get water proof covers and good straps. I stopped every 3 hours to make sure load was secure and drove over 700 miles without any issues. The rack will make whistle noise because of the wind passing through the bars but I just toned it out and blasted the radio . The product is great and sturdy easy on and easy off. My only complaint is putting on the wind guard. I couldn’t figure it out because the instructions have poor information on the wind plate. How to Set Up Your Yakima SkinnyWarrior Roof Rack Cargo Basket on a 2020 Toyota RAV4
Hey everybody, Cooper here at etrailer. Today, we're going to be taking a look at the Yakima SkinnyWarrior Roof Rack Cargo Basket on our 2020 Toyota RAV4. Now, for something like a rooftop cargo basket, what uses does it have Well, if you're wanting to carry around some of those bigger, bulkier items, maybe like fishing rods and wanting to keep them out of your vehicle, or maybe just need some additional storage space, all of those are perfectly legitimate regions for needing a rooftop cargo basket like this. Our rooftop basket is going to have a weight capacity of 165 pounds, but do keep in mind that our roof rack system, as well as some of the components on our car might have their own separate weight capacities, and we wanna make sure we are catering to our lowest number possible. That way, we just don't overload anything and potentially cause any permanent damage to any of our systems. Carrier is going to weigh 23 pounds, which is pretty impressive.

Fit Check: Testing Curt Roof Mounted Cargo Basket on a 2016 Toyota RAV4
Today on our 2016 Toyota RAV4, we're going to be doing a test fit on the Curt Roof Mounted Basket. That's part number C18115. It measures 41 and 1/2 inches long, 37 inches wide, and 4 inches deep. If you'd like to pick up an extension for the Curt basket here you can pick one up sold separately, part number C18117. What that's going to do is it's going add an extra 21 inches here at the center. So if you feel the need to pick up an extension go ahead and do so. Like anything else that you might put on the roof of your RAV4 you always want to be sure you leave enough clearance so you can open up your rear hatch.
